我有一个简单的SPA和应用程序和关于组件如下所示。当我单击About链接时,about页面会出现在这些链接下。问题是,当我点击“关于我”链接时,加载的是“我”页面,而不是“关于”页面。我真正想要的是在nextjs中实现嵌套路由。看起来一级路由正在加载。但是我不知道如何将它添加到我的子组件中。
import App, { Container } from 'next/app'
import React from 'react'
import Link from 'next/link'
class MyApp extends App {
stat
我有一个使用kubernetes集群和MySQL后端的Node/React应用程序。我发现,当同时命中相同的路由时,每个后续的请求都会变得相当慢,并且对于数据负载稍大的一些路由(例如,一个页面返回330 MySQL行),请求会导致kubernetes pods崩溃和请求超时。这会导致服务器错误,并使站点不可用。
100个请求(10个并发)的测试结果见下文:Percentage of the requests served within a certain time (ms) 50% 711 66% 850 75% 1105 80% 1199 90%
当我在本地服务器上重新加载我的应用程序时,一切正常。但是当我在gh-pages上重新加载页面时,我得到了一个404错误。它不会在主页上执行此操作,但在其他两个页面上会执行此操作。这与它被远程托管的事实有关吗?我是React Router的新手。任何帮助都会是appreciated.Here是相关的代码和下面我的应用程序的链接:
import { BrowserRouter as Router, Route, Switch } from "react-router-dom";
class App extends Component {
render() {
ret
问题:当我最初进入根时,路由器会呈现正确的页面。导航也很好。但是,当我点击refresh时,应用程序崩溃时会出现以下错误:
instrument.js:112 Uncaught TypeError: Cannot read property 'length' of undefined
这是instrument.js:112中的函数。computedStates是undefined。
/**
* Runs the reducer on invalidated actions to get a fresh computation log.
*/
function recompu
我正在尝试使用react- router -dom进行路由,但是我的URL正在更新,但是页面没有路由到我指定的组件。这是我的App.js
import "./App.css";
import { BrowserRouter, Route, Switch } from "react-router-dom";
import Menu from "./layouts/Menu";
import Dashboard from "./layouts/Dashboard";
import Content from "./layouts
我跟踪Shopify's guide,直到第四步结束,开发了一个下一个JS应用程序,我已经设置了两个页面(嵌入式应用程序导航),主页和Page1。现在,当我点击打开两个页面时,应用程序正在进行重新加载,而不是路由... 您可以在这里看到闪烁的问题- https://youtu.be/45RvYgxC7C0 在这方面的任何帮助都将非常感谢。 _app.js import React from "react";
import App from "next/app";
import Head from "next/head";
impor
我在导航到结帐页面时遇到了麻烦。每当我点击应用程序中的篮子图标时,我可以看到URL正在改变,但是页面没有变化,我总是必须刷新页面才能进行导航,我也不知道为什么。
这是我的App.js代码:
import React from "react";
import './App.css';
import Header from './Header';
import Home from "./Home";
import { BrowserRouter as Router, Switch, Route}
from "react-rou